AI Platform for Restaurant Waste Reduction

Automated restaurant food waste reduction platform: Problem is 30-40% of perishable inventory wasted due to poor demand forecasting in independent restaurants. Solution is an AI camera + POS integration system that predicts daily demand and auto-generates supplier orders while flagging near-expiry items for dynamic pricing. Target audience is 10-50 location restaurant groups. Why now: Rising labor costs and 2025 ESG reporting mandates create urgent demand; can start with SaaS pilots. Differentiator: Focus on multi-location chain APIs rather than single-store tools, with automated supplier marketplace.

Competition Analysis

Score: 70/100

Several companies offer waste reduction solutions, but few focus on automation and integration with multi-location chains. Competitors include BlueCart (inventory management) and Winnow (AI food waste tracking).

BlueCart

Inventory management system for restaurants

Strengths: Established customer base, Comprehensive inventory tools

Weaknesses: Lack of AI-driven automation

Winnow

AI food waste tracking system

Strengths: AI expertise, Strong focus on waste reduction

Weaknesses: Limited POS integration
